Topology Constraint Validator

scripts/validate-topology-constraints.mjs is a local contract validator for the MVP topology rules that were prose-only after M0. It reads fixtures from fixtures/mvp/topology-constraints/ and does not call DEV, PROD, real hardware, databases, secrets, or service endpoints.

Run it locally:

node scripts/validate-topology-constraints.mjs

Contract

  • The fixture must describe a DEV topology with hwlab-box-simu, hwlab-gateway-simu, and one active hwlab-patch-panel status object.
  • Cross-device propagation must remain patch-panel-only. Box simulator local loopback is not a valid substitute for cross-device sync.
  • Wiring endpoints must reference known box resources and declared ports.
  • Active wiring configs must not contain resource-level directed cycles.
  • Active config exclusivity is enforced per project and resource group. The resource group is wiringConfig.constraints.resourceGroupId when present; otherwise it is the sorted set of resources touched by the config.
  • A resource group may have only one active wiring config unless the active patch panel reports metadata.activeConfigOverride.
  • A patch-panel override is valid only when it is reported by an active hwlab-patch-panel, preserves patch-panel-only, lists exactly the active config ids for the resource group, gives a non-empty reason, and selects the same wiringConfigId as the patch panel status object.
  • The patch panel's activeConnections must match the selected wiring config.

Fixtures

Fixture Expected result Purpose
valid-topology.json valid One active acyclic config routed by hwlab-patch-panel.
invalid-cycle.json wiring_cycle Detects a directed resource cycle in active wiring.
invalid-multiple-active-configs.json active_config_exclusivity Rejects multiple active configs in the same resource group without an override.
invalid-patch-panel-override.json patch_panel_override_invalid Rejects a patch-panel override whose selected config disagrees with patch panel state.

Each fixture stores expectedValidation beside the topology. The validator passes only when valid fixtures produce no violations and invalid fixtures produce the expected violation code set. This makes the validator a pre-DEV contract for the future real M3 flow while keeping the current M3 hardware loop smoke focused on local patch-panel behavior.
